GUY vs SFU Match Prediction – Who will win today’s GSL match? | CricTracker

The stage is set as the Guyana Amazon Warriors (GUY) will be crossing swords with the San Francisco Unicorns (SFU) in the Final of the ongoing Global Super League (GSL) 2026 in a thrilling encounter at the Providence Stadium, Guyana, on Sunday, August 02.

The Guyana Amazon Warriors have played like a dominant side throughout the season, as they topped the leaderboard at the end of the league stage. Winning three out of the four games they have played, the Guyanese side also was the only team with six points on the table. They will now be looking to put up a similar performance to lift the title once again.

San Francisco Unicorns, on the other hand, have shown a tremendous amount of dominance in the lead-up to the final, claiming a spot in the glory encounter in their first-ever attempt. They have recently tasted success by winning the MLC 2026 and would certainly not mind doubling it up with a victory against the Amazon Warriors.

Providence Stadium, Guyana: Pitch Report

Throughout the Global Super League season, the surface at Providence Stadium in Guyana has produced pitches which are relatively difficult to bat on, especially in the first innings. However, the conditions in the wickets here are expected to get much better as the match progresses. Any total in excess of 200-220 can be a winning total, but the chasing side is expected to reign supreme.

GUY vs SFU: Probable Best Performers of the Match

Probable Best Batter: Tim Robinson

Tim Robinson has been in superb form throughout the GSL 2026, having scored a whopping 197 runs from just five innings. The opening batter is also topping the run-scoring charts in the season currently and will be hoping to build on his form in the upcoming contest. He also scored an unbeaten, match-winning half-century in the qualifier match that helped the San Francisco-based franchise make an entry into the finals. 

Probable Best Bowler: Mohammad Nabi

The experience of Mohammad Nabi is showing, like anything, in GSL for the Guyana-based franchise. Not only has Nabi managed to stem the flow of runs, but he has also managed to pick seven wickets in just four outings at a mind-boggling average of 11.42. His slow right-arm off-spin can cause troubles to the opposition in the contest on Sunday and eventually lead the side to glory.
